Transaction 5986be7b92c690af3e0558dae08fdf64ba32dc8e021af0ef29193212a5e1f17a

24 Input
2 Outputs
  • 5986be7b92c690af3e0558dae08fdf64ba32dc8e021af0ef29193212a5e1f17a:0
  • value  1100000000
    address  39EiWgdQqcrBJwuyqoTg8n8qNh7EJRA3hP
  • 5986be7b92c690af3e0558dae08fdf64ba32dc8e021af0ef29193212a5e1f17a:1
  • value  13653824
    address  321ar2QPxUpeDjmRtT6QkBVnMd5Z3V2uSW